Output df60394a29b24da359366ff9196a2b031c155a2150150119ebbcffdb2cdc2d97:192

value
562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25c2eb45959c955da54b951a08792665adfea4ead0665ae27e52d56eacd5f395
address
bc1pyhpwk3v4nj24mf2tj5dqs7fxvkklaf826pn94cn72t2katx47w2s60n52k
transaction
df60394a29b24da359366ff9196a2b031c155a2150150119ebbcffdb2cdc2d97
confirmations
23597
spent
true